在日常开发中,很多时候我们需要实现一些促销活动,例如“满加优惠”的逻辑。在这篇博文中,我将详细介绍如何在 Python 中实现满加优惠的优惠算法。接下来,让我们深入探讨这个问题的背景、出现的错误现象、根因分析、解决方案、验证测试和预防优化等方面。
## 问题背景
在电商平台中,促销活动是吸引顾客并提升销售的主要手段之一。例如,一些平台会提供“满100减20”的优惠活动。用户在购买时,如果商品总
# Python满减优惠计算详解
在现代电子商务中,促销手段层出不穷,其中"满减优惠"是消费者和商家都非常喜欢的一种优惠方式。这种方式通常表现为:消费者在购买商品时,消费达到一定金额后可以享受直接的价格减免。为了帮助你更好地理解并实现满减优惠,我们将通过一个实例来探讨如何使用Python编程来处理这一问题。
## 实际问题
假设一家在线商店希望实施满减活动,如下所示:
- 满200元,减3
# 实现“Python优惠满”
## 流程概述
首先,我们需要明确整个实现“Python优惠满”的流程。下面是整个流程的步骤:
步骤 | 操作
--- | ---
1 | 输入购买的商品数量和单价
2 | 计算总价
3 | 根据不同的优惠条件计算优惠金额
4 | 打印出总价、优惠金额和实际支付金额
接下来,我们将逐步介绍每一步需要做什么,以及相应的代码和注释。
## 步骤1:输入购买的商
原创
2023-08-24 05:42:04
229阅读
# Python优惠满减
## 导语
在日常生活中,我们经常会遇到各种优惠活动,比如满减活动。满减活动是商家为了吸引更多的顾客而提供的一种优惠方式。在本文中,我们将介绍如何使用Python编程语言来实现一个简单的优惠满减功能。
## 什么是满减活动
满减活动是指在购买商品时,当达到一定的购买金额条件时,商家会给予顾客一定的折扣或减免金额。比如某商家在满200元的情况下,可以减免50元,那么
原创
2023-09-01 03:45:27
544阅读
在这篇博文中,我们将详细探讨如何处理一个常见的商业场景:“python优惠满减简易”。这个问题通常涉及到复杂的计算和数据处理,我们会一步步引导你通过这个整个过程。
## 环境准备
首先,我们需要准备一个合适的开发环境。下面的表格展示了我们使用的技术栈以及它们的兼容性:
| 技术栈 | 版本 | 兼容性 |
|
# Python实现满500九折优惠的简单示例
在我们日常生活中,电商平台常常会推出这样的促销活动:满一定金额后享受九折优惠。例如:购物满500元,即可享受9折优惠,这种营销策略能够有效促使消费者进行更多购买。今天,我们就来用Python实现这样一个简单的计算程序,帮助我们理解这个优惠如何实现。
## 1. 需求分析
首先,我们需要明确实现的功能:
- 输入用户购买的商品价格
- 判断总金额
在现代电商环境中,满减活动是吸引顾客的重要策略之一。作为一名IT从业者,我时常深入研究如何在Python中实现这种价格调整逻辑,以便更好地支持业务需求。这篇博文将详细描述我在实现“python满减活动”的过程中所遇到的问题、解决方案和相关的技术细节。
### 问题背景
在我们的电商平台中,需要实现一个满减活动,支持用户在结账时根据购物车金额自动计算折扣。业务影响分析显示,如果购物车满减逻辑实现
www.002pc.com对《京东python抢券脚本Python内置函数——str》总结来说,为我们学习Python很实用。str[code]str([object])转换为string类型[code]In [2]: S = str('abc')In [3]: S.S.capitalize S.find S.isspace S.partition S.rstrip S.translateS.ce
转载
2024-01-25 22:06:57
88阅读
还原下现场:某天下午, 运营反馈说网页打开很卡。经过排查发现服务器内存被写满,除了内存被写满以后, 其他都是正常的。内存大部分都是被usedcache并没有占用多少处理方案: 首先紧急释放内存使用命令
echo 3 > /proc/sys/vm/drop_caches在我的理解上, 内存是会自动回收的。但是这次很明显是并没有回收内存引起的。 所以花了点时间研究了一下内存的回收机制:Linux
转载
2024-06-23 13:41:35
94阅读
生成二维码并显示1. Visual Studio > 右击项目名 > Manage NuGet Packages... > 搜索Spire.Barcode并安装。当前版本是v3.5.0,VS用的是VS Community 2017 Version 15.9.122. Program.cs中Main函数内添加如下代码,生成QR Code: 1 using Spire.B
前言今天我们来搭建优惠券平台项目的另外两个模块,coupon-calculation-serv(优惠计算服务)和 coupon-customer-serv(用户服务),组建一个完整的实战项目应用(middleware 模块将在 Spring Cloud 环节进行搭建)。通过今天的课程,你可以巩固并加深 Spring Boot 的实操能力,为接下来 Spring Cloud 微服务化改造打好前置知识
转载
2024-02-02 19:51:28
114阅读
# Python中的临时文件和磁盘空间问题
在Python中,临时文件是一种常用的资源,尤其是在处理数据和文件时。`tempfile`模块提供了一种方便的方法来创建和操作临时文件和临时目录。然而,随着大量临时文件的创建,可能会导致磁盘空间被占满,从而影响系统的运行。因此,了解如何有效地使用`tempfile`和管理临时文件的生命周期就显得尤为重要。
## 1. tempfile模块基础
`t
描述最近天气炎热,小Ho天天宅在家里叫外卖。他常吃的一家餐馆一共有N道菜品,价格分别是A1, A2, ... AN
原创
2022-08-10 10:44:53
78阅读
# Java优惠券满减算法

```mermaid
journey
title Java优惠券满减算法
section 用户领取优惠券
定义变量 couponId 并赋值为用户领取的优惠券id
定义变量 userId 并赋值为用户id
定义变量 orderAmount 并赋值为订单总金额
原创
2023-11-03 11:31:20
80阅读
# Java求满减优惠组合问题解决方案
## 1. 整件事情的流程
为了解决Java求满减优惠组合问题,我们需要按照以下步骤进行:
```mermaid
sequenceDiagram
小白 ->> 经验丰富的开发者: 请求帮助解决Java求满减优惠组合问题
经验丰富的开发者 -->> 小白: 解决方案
```
## 2. 每一步的具体操作和代码示例
### 步骤一:读入
原创
2024-05-06 03:35:32
69阅读
文章目录前言一、注释二、用法三、数据类型总结 前言Hello,各位小伙伴大家好,我是紫水晶的微光。本篇文章我将跟大家分享Python的注释、用法和数据类型。我会在其中穿插与c/c++/JavaScript语言的对比。快来跟我一起学习吧! 一、注释 Python中单行注释用#,多行注释用''' '''。当然
转载
2023-08-11 16:28:39
235阅读
今天是我们学习Python的第二天,任务似乎有些多,如果有错误的地方希望大家给nullptr.cpp在下方留言,首先谢谢大家的观看??? 运算符_循坏语句 _字符串格式化?.运算符? 五个必须掌握的运算符? 运算符的优先级?.分支和循坏语句? if and else 分支语句? while循坏 and for循坏? while循坏? for循坏?.字符串格式化? 使用%进行格式化? format(
## Hive任务磁盘写满怎么优化
在大数据处理过程中,使用Apache Hive作为数据仓库的工具,可以进行大规模数据分析和查询。尽管Hive提供了强大的功能,但在任务执行中,磁盘写满是一个常见的问题,可能导致任务失败和系统性能下降。本文将探讨如何优化Hive任务,避免磁盘写满的问题,并提供一些实用的代码示例。
### 1. 理解问题的根源
磁盘写满的问题通常是以下几个因素造成的:
-
原创
2024-08-31 05:02:14
117阅读
# 如何用 Python 将 CPU 写满
对于刚入行的小白程序员来说,理解如何让 CPU 的资源被充分利用是一个非常重要的课题。在这篇文章中,我们将逐步学习如何用 Python 编写代码,将计算机的 CPU 算力充分利用、达到 "写满" 的目的。整件事的流程比较简单,我们将通过一系列定义好的步骤进行实现。
## 流程概述
以下是将 CPU 写满的基本流程:
| 步骤 | 描述
原创
2024-08-02 06:48:44
203阅读
# Java中如何算最优惠的折扣满减方案
在购物过程中,商家通常会提供一些折扣和满减活动来吸引消费者。为了确保消费者能够获得最大的优惠,我们可以通过编写一个Java程序来计算各种折扣满减方案的最优解。
## 问题描述
假设有一家商店提供了以下折扣优惠方案:
1. 折扣:购买指定商品时,享受一定折扣比例。
2. 满减:购买满一定金额时,减去固定金额。
现在给定一组商品和其对应的价格,以及商
原创
2024-05-18 06:44:18
206阅读